Summer Serenade
Jia Viviene Chen, was born into privilege. A political dynasty backs her every move, and like a modern-day princess, she always gets what she wants. Maarte, matapobre, selfish-she grew up spoiled by wealth and power, shielded from the consequences of her actions.
Keira Collete Saito, lives a very different life. Raised by her hardworking father, Tadashi, alongside her younger sister Sayaka, she knows the value of perseverance. With little but love and grit, Keira and Sayaka never take anything for granted. Their shared dream is music-to form a band and touch lives with their songs. Often, the sisters busk on street corners, pouring their hearts into performances that bring joy to strangers.
But one cruel summer changes everything. Jia, reckless and drunk behind the wheel, slams her car into Keira and Sayaka as they finish a night of busking. Both sisters are left injured, but Sayaka suffers the most-her body broken, her hearing lost forever.
Jia, protected by her family's political power, escapes justice. Yet the damage is irreversible. Keira blames herself for not protecting her sister, while Sayaka struggles to face a world of silence. Their music, once their bond and dream, is shattered.
Now, Keira must decide whether to let tragedy break her-or to fight for her sister, their dream, and justice against the girl who took it all away.
